Low-Paid Nurses in Sofia Emergency Hospital Go on Strike

Sofia News Agency, January 25, 2007 Nurses from the biggest emergency hospital in Sofia went on a strike on Thursday, demanding higher pays. The nurses from the central operating theatre were joined in their protest by their colleagues from other wards of the hospital as well as their assistants. They refused to enter the theatres, causing a total of eighteen scheduled surgeries to be cancelled. The protestors assured that they would not boycott emergency cases. ... Low-Paid
